Professor Terje Haukaas University of British Columbia, Vancouver Notation

Similar documents
VECTORS, TENSORS AND INDEX NOTATION

Linear Algebra March 16, 2019

Introduction to tensors and dyadics

Mathematical Preliminaries

A Primer on Three Vectors

Vector, Matrix, and Tensor Derivatives

Cartesian Tensors. e 2. e 1. General vector (formal definition to follow) denoted by components

Physics 110. Electricity and Magnetism. Professor Dine. Spring, Handout: Vectors and Tensors: Everything You Need to Know

MATH 320, WEEK 7: Matrices, Matrix Operations

Elements of Continuum Elasticity. David M. Parks Mechanics and Materials II February 25, 2004

Chapter 4 - MATRIX ALGEBRA. ... a 2j... a 2n. a i1 a i2... a ij... a in

Tensor Transformations and the Maximum Shear Stress. (Draft 1, 1/28/07)

Table of mathematical symbols - Wikipedia, the free encyclopedia

ICS 6N Computational Linear Algebra Matrix Algebra

The Matrix Representation of a Three-Dimensional Rotation Revisited

Math 123, Week 2: Matrix Operations, Inverses

We wish to solve a system of N simultaneous linear algebraic equations for the N unknowns x 1, x 2,...,x N, that are expressed in the general form

Mathematics for Graphics and Vision

Elementary maths for GMT

Linear Equations and Matrix

CS 246 Review of Linear Algebra 01/17/19

B553 Lecture 5: Matrix Algebra Review

2.20 Fall 2018 Math Review

Vectors. September 2, 2015

A primer on matrices

Matrix Algebra: Vectors

Chapter 2 - Basics Structures MATH 213. Chapter 2: Basic Structures. Dr. Eric Bancroft. Fall Dr. Eric Bancroft MATH 213 Fall / 60

Matrices and Vectors

Matrices: 2.1 Operations with Matrices

Tensors, and differential forms - Lecture 2

Vectors, metric and the connection

Lecture 3: Vectors. Any set of numbers that transform under a rotation the same way that a point in space does is called a vector.

Introduction to Tensor Notation

Dot Products, Transposes, and Orthogonal Projections

1 Matrices and matrix algebra

Math review. Math review

A Review of Matrix Analysis

ADDITIONAL MATHEMATICS

Vector Spaces. Chapter 1

1.4 LECTURE 4. Tensors and Vector Identities

1. Vectors.

Introduction to Quantitative Techniques for MSc Programmes SCHOOL OF ECONOMICS, MATHEMATICS AND STATISTICS MALET STREET LONDON WC1E 7HX

Cartesian Tensors. e 2. e 1. General vector (formal definition to follow) denoted by components

Kevin James. MTHSC 3110 Section 2.1 Matrix Operations

Computational Fluid Dynamics Prof. Dr. Suman Chakraborty Department of Mechanical Engineering Indian Institute of Technology, Kharagpur

Chapter 8 Vectors and Scalars

(But, they are entirely separate branches of mathematics.)

Matrix Multiplication

Lecture Notes in Linear Algebra

Algebra Workshops 10 and 11

Linear Algebra Review. Vectors

Chapter 2 - Basics Structures

Matrices BUSINESS MATHEMATICS

Chapter 2. Linear Algebra. rather simple and learning them will eventually allow us to explain the strange results of

MITOCW ocw nov2005-pt1-220k_512kb.mp4

Classical Mechanics in Hamiltonian Form

Index Notation for Vector Calculus

Algorithmic Game Theory and Applications. Lecture 4: 2-player zero-sum games, and the Minimax Theorem

b 1 b 2.. b = b m A = [a 1,a 2,...,a n ] where a 1,j a 2,j a j = a m,j Let A R m n and x 1 x 2 x = x n

PHYS 705: Classical Mechanics. Rigid Body Motion Introduction + Math Review

GG303 Lecture 6 8/27/09 1 SCALARS, VECTORS, AND TENSORS

Lecture 13 Notes, Electromagnetic Theory II Dr. Christopher S. Baird, faculty.uml.edu/cbaird University of Massachusetts Lowell

10. Linear Systems of ODEs, Matrix multiplication, superposition principle (parts of sections )

Newtonian Mechanics. Chapter Classical space-time

Phys 201. Matrices and Determinants

1. Tensor of Rank 2 If Φ ij (x, y) satisfies: (a) having four components (9 for 3-D). (b) when the coordinate system is changed from x i to x i,

Matrix operations Linear Algebra with Computer Science Application

Two matrices of the same size are added by adding their corresponding entries =.

The Matrix Algebra of Sample Statistics

Math Camp II. Basic Linear Algebra. Yiqing Xu. Aug 26, 2014 MIT

DS-GA 1002 Lecture notes 0 Fall Linear Algebra. These notes provide a review of basic concepts in linear algebra.

VECTOR AND TENSOR ALGEBRA

1.1.1 Algebraic Operations

Matrix Algebra & Elementary Matrices

Page 52. Lecture 3: Inner Product Spaces Dual Spaces, Dirac Notation, and Adjoints Date Revised: 2008/10/03 Date Given: 2008/10/03

We are already familiar with the concept of a scalar and vector. are unit vectors in the x and y directions respectively with

M. Matrices and Linear Algebra

REVIEW Chapter 1 The Real Number System

Physics 6303 Lecture 2 August 22, 2018

Dr. Tess J. Moon, (office), (fax),

Some vector algebra and the generalized chain rule Ross Bannister Data Assimilation Research Centre, University of Reading, UK Last updated 10/06/10

Basic Concepts in Linear Algebra

Basic Math Review for CS4830

Review of Linear Algebra

Linear Algebra and Matrix Inversion

. a m1 a mn. a 1 a 2 a = a n

2. Matrix Algebra and Random Vectors

Notes on Linear Algebra I. # 1

Some Notes on Linear Algebra

MAE 323: Lecture 1. Review

Lecture 3 Linear Algebra Background

Matrix Arithmetic. j=1

ADDITIONAL MATHEMATICS

MATRIX ALGEBRA AND SYSTEMS OF EQUATIONS. + + x 1 x 2. x n 8 (4) 3 4 2

Basic Linear Algebra in MATLAB

SEBASTIAN RASCHKA. Introduction to Artificial Neural Networks and Deep Learning. with Applications in Python

A primer on matrices

x n -2.5 Definition A list is a list of objects, where multiplicity is allowed, and order matters. For example, as lists

Symmetry and Properties of Crystals (MSE638) Stress and Strain Tensor

[POLS 8500] Review of Linear Algebra, Probability and Information Theory

Transcription:

Notation This document establishes the notation that is employed throughout these notes. It is intended as a look-up source during the study of other documents and software on this website. As a general rule, symbols that represent a scalar physical quantity, such as a length, L, are written in Italics. Functions and operators, such as the probability, P( ), and the sine function, sin( ), are not. When vector and matrix notation is employed then vectors and matrices are written in boldface, such as the matrix D. As explained later in this document, index notation employs Italics, like with symbols, e.g., D ij. Vector and Index Notation An important class of objects in engineering analysis is vectors and matrices. More generically they are referred to as tensors. These objects are expressed either in vector notation or in index notation. Sometimes the phrase matrix notation is used instead of vector notation. Similarly, tensor notation is sometimes used instead of the phrase index notation. Vector notation is most appealing to the untrained eye. Boldface clearly identifies vectors and matrices. One example is Ax=b. In vector notation, upper case usually refers to matrices and lower case refers to vectors. However, although it is visually appealing vector notation is somewhat limiting in rigorous analysis. In such circumstances index notation is an appealing alternative. In index notation, a vector a is written a i, where i is an index that runs through nonnegative integers. Depending on convention, the index starts at 0 or 1. In index notation, a matrix A is written A ij, where the first index is the row number and the second index is the column number. Tensors of higher dimensions follow naturally, such as C ijk. A key advantage of index notation is that each object that being a vector, matrix, or higher-order tensor is treated as a scalar. After the calculations are carried out, the result can be presented in vector notation for visual appeal. Index notation is also appealing when the equations are implemented on the computer. Structured programming blocks, such as for-loops, can use the same indices as those in the index notation. Einstein s summation convention is vital to the attractiveness of index notation. To understand this rule, consider first a vector-matrix product. Like in ordinary algebra, two vectors or matrices written adjacent to each other implies multiplication. For example, Ax=b means that the matrix A should be multiplied by the vector x to get the vector b. Specifically, the first component of b is the sum of the products of the components of the first row of A with the components of x. By hand, this product is conveniently carried out in a Gant diagram: Notation Updated February 12, 2014 Page 1

A 11 A 12 A 13 A 11 + A 12 + A 13 (1) A 21 A 22 A 23 A 21 + A 22 + A 23 A 31 A 32 A 33 A 31 + A 32 + A 33 The Gant diagram becomes particularly attractive when more than two vectors/matrices are multiplied by hand calculation. By using the summation symbol, the product is written 3 b i = A ij a j (2) Einstein s summation convention allows Eq. (2) to be written in shorthand as j =1 b i = A ij a j (3) because the rule states that summation should be taken over any index that is repeated in a term. In this case that is j, because it appears twice in the term. This makes j a dummy index in Eq. (3); it serves only the summation purpose. Conversely, i is called a free index because it appears only once in each term. In the following examples of multiplication in vector and index notation, notice which are the free indices, and which are dummy indices. Also notice the following: The free indices reveals the dimension of the final result Unless there is a transpose the neighbouring indices are the same Transpose switches order of the indices of a matrix If there is a transpose, then neighbouring indices are no longer identical, but the range of the neighbouring indices must be the same The transpose of a vector does not affect the index notation; is an artifact of vectors being considered column vectors by default The ordering of the objects, i.e., vectors and matrices, in index notation is immaterial, while the order of the objects in vector notation is crucial Free: ik AB = A ij (4) Free: im ABC = A ij C km (5) Free: i Ax = A ij (6) Free: ik A T B = A ji (7) Free: i A T x = A ji (8) Notation Updated February 12, 2014 Page 2

Free: ik (AB) T = ( A ij ) T = A kj B ji = B ji A kj = B T A T (9) Free: none (scalar) x T Ax = x i A ij (10) Free: none (scalar) (Ax) T (Ax) = A ij A ik x k = A ji A ik x k = x T A T Ax (11) Notice in particular the steps taken in Eq. (9). In the first equality it is decided that i and k are the free indices, hence the final result must have the indices ik, in that order. In the second equality the indices ik are flipped to ki because of the transpose. In the third equality, the order of B and A is flipped to achieve a final result that has indices ik. In the last equality it is recognized that both A and B must be transposed to make the dummy inde in A be a neighbour to the dummy inde in B. Notation for Derivatives The ordinary way of writing a derivative is d dx or for ordinary and partial differentiation, respectively. For derivatives with respect to time, x is replaced with t. However, notational shortcuts are often employed. For spatial derivatives, the most common ones apply the prime and the comma. Each prime denotes one differentiation with respect to the obvious variable, for example: x (12) f '(x) and f ''(x) (13) In contrast, the use of comma is more closely associated with index notation, and shows explicitly the variable with respect to which differentiation is carried out. For example, σ ij,i (14) states that the stress component σ ij is differentiated in the i-direction. Such derivatives with respect to a vector of variables, but of a single function of those variables, say h(x), are sometimes written by the nabla symbol: h x i = x h (15) Conversely, the common short-hand notation for derivative with respect to time is a superimposed dot: Displacement: Velocity: Acceleration: u u u (16) Notation Updated February 12, 2014 Page 3

Mathematical Notation Let x + 4, where + 4 = {x n x i 0, i}, and let q,w. Furthermore, let f : x,q w. Consequently, f : + 4. This is one way of stating that a quantity, w, is determined by some function, f, which takes as input four positive numbers that are collected in a vector, x, as well as a quantity q. This is a mathematical way of describing how a displacement, w, is obtained from a load, q, acting on a beam with four properties collected in the vector x, presumably cross-sectional dimensions, member length, and modulus of elasticity. Such mathematical language is useful in rigorous and compact engineering analysis. However, in the beginning in can make the material harder to understand. Do not despair; the prominent mathematician John von Neumann said that: In mathematics you don't understand things. You just get used to them. This section is intended to provide help in that process. The most commonly used symbols are: = is equal to is not equal to is approximately equal to is proportional to is defined as (this can also be written ) < is less than > is greater than is much less than is much greater than + plus minus multiplied by / divided by given that the cross product of vectors or the Cartesian product : is such that for all maps the element into the element maps the set into the set the set of real numbers ( n is an n-dimensional space of real numbers) the set of integers ( n is an n-dimensional space of integers) the set of complex numbers ( n is an n-dimensional space of complex numbers) the set of rational numbers, i.e., numbers that can be expressed as a fraction ( n is an n-dimensional space of rational numbers) the set of natural number, i.e., non-negative integers ( n is an n-dimensional space of natural numbers) partial derivative nabla or the gradient of that returns the vector of partial derivatives with respect to the function s parameters x same as the nabla operator, but specifically identifying the vector of parameters that differentiation is with respect to Notation Updated February 12, 2014 Page 4

there exists is an element of is a subset of union intersection the null set sum of product of infinity the norm of (for vectors, the square root of sum of squares) Notation Updated February 12, 2014 Page 5